The Doc McStuffin Light-up Doctor Shoes from Flair, are made from glitter jelly material and have a motion activated light on both shoes. They have a flower pattern on front of the shoes and each shoe has a Pink heart each featuring a picture of Doc McStuffin, Lambie and Stuffy emblem. It’s this emblem that flashes with motion. The Shoes are backless so more like a clog style shoe and suitable for children aged 3 years plus.
Although they say the shoes are suitable from three years plus I would say they are too big for a three year old. Erin is currently in a size 7 shoe and the shoes were huge on her although this hasn’t stopped her using and enjoying them. But she obviously can’t run in them as they would slip off and she could hurt herself as a result.
Erin is really taken with the flashing lights on the shoes and spends ages activating them, she’s even picking them up to make them go off when she’s not wearing them! Erin has also been wearing the Doc McStuffin Light-up Doctor Shoes when playing with her other Doc McStuffin toys.
I can certainly see these shoes being a firm favourite for a long time to come, which is probably the only good thing about them being big on her at the moment.
